13 rivers register rise, 69 fall

DHAKA, Oct 31, 2018 (BSS) – Water levels in 13 river stations monitored by
Flood Forecasting and Warning Centre (FFWC) have marked rises and 69 stations
recorded falls.

Among the 94 monitored water level stations, ten stations have been
registered steady, a bulletin issued by FFWC said today.

All the major rivers are flowing below their respective danger levels.

The Brahmaputra-Jamuna and the Ganges-Padma rivers are in falling trend
which may continue in next five days.

Except Surma, other major rivers of Upper Meghna basin are in falling
trend, which may continue for the next 48 hours.
